Your Mission: Day to Day Responsibilities
- Provide expert consultancy on supply chain strategies to diverse clients.
- Lead inventory planning to maintain optimal stock levels and prevent over/understocking.
- Support the forecasting team with updates and development of demand forecasts.
- Execute key supply chain operations: manage suppliers, place orders, arrange freight, and coordinate 3PL.
- Ensure smooth replenishment to fulfillment centers and manage inventory reconciliations.
- Oversee landed cost calculations, track payments, and maintain key documents.
- Continuously seek ways to optimize supply chain costs and boost operational efficiency.
- Bachelor’s degree in Business, Economics, or Engineering (Supply Chain Management preferred).
- 2+ years in supply chain management (excluding internships).
- 1+ years of experience with Amazon’s ecosystem.
- Strong English communication skills, both written and verbal.
- Proficient in spreadsheets and data analysis.
- Ready for an immediate start.
